Resident Evil 4 Remake Bonus Content Comes at a Costly Price Tag

This could be of interest to you, stranger. Capcom appears to be channeling their inner merchant with the Resident Evil 4 Remake additional stuff. While many of the treasures in the Deluxe Edition Extra DLC Pack are merely decorative in nature, some fans have found one unusual outlier in the mix. This Treasure Map provides more trinkets to uncover during the Resident Evil 4 Remake, ultimately compelling gamers to acquire the Deluxe Edition if they want to experience everything the game has to offer.

For quite some time, it has been unknown what this new DLC Treasure Map would bring to the game, but some astute fans may have unearthed the truth. Capcom, like previous Resident Evil remakes, lets gamers to purchase specific components of the Deluxe Edition separately.

The Treasure Map’s official description on the Microsoft Xbox store reads, “Discover the hidden treasures that await!” Additional goodies will be put around the game using this map. Some of these riches are only available through this means.”

The retailer also mentions that you may check the location of more treasures on your map during the main plot. It is unclear what these extra treasures are for, but they are clearly not included in the original game purchase. Many gamers are fed up with having to pay extra money for material that goes beyond simply aesthetics.

Resident Evil 4 Remake appears to be the ultimate version of the classic game. It was recently reported that the game would incorporate new material to keep the title fresh while remaining faithful to the original and not removing chapters. Hopefully, the added treasures from the Deluxe Edition Extra DLC Pack don’t have too much of an influence on gameplay, otherwise this might be a thorn in the side of one of the year’s most anticipated releases.
